Three Maghrebi voices unite at Bouregreg

The 44th edition of the Bouncerine International Festival hosted a musical evening titled "The Way of Malouf" yesterday. The event brought together three Maghrebi artists: Sufian Al-Zaydi from Tunisia, Abbas Al-Riqli from Algeria, and Ridwan Shabib from Libya, taking the audience on a journey through the musical heritage of Malouf in the Maghreb. The performance was divided into three parts, each focusing on the Malouf school from Tunisia, Algeria, and Libya, highlighting the diversity of modes and styles in performing this ancient art that reflects the shared cultural identity of the region. The show also emphasized that, despite its varying origins and development across the Maghreb countries, Malouf remains a fundamental unifying element of the collective musical memory. It underscored that this heritage is alive and capable of evolving with the times. The evening reaffirmed the importance of preserving and developing this musical legacy, illustrating the deep connection between the peoples of the region through this shared art form. It carried messages of unity and cultural dialogue among the Maghrebi nations.
